Totalitarianism is a form of government where the government has complete control over private and political lives of its citizens. Stalin monitored telephone lines, read mail and had spies everywhere. Those that opposed him were killed and his secret police patrolled Russia. All newspapers, magazines, etc had to be approved by the Soviet Union. Propaganda was also in every corner of Russia. By using propaganda, he could instill fear.
